- Adaptive Learning
The student is presented with challenging or easier questions based on his/her performance in the initial exercises of a course.
Our normal path is “intermediate” for Activities 1 and 2.
Numerical Drills: If a student scores greater than 85% in Activity 1 and Activity 2, the student is given an “Advanced” track in Activity 3.
If the student scores < 75% in both exercises, he/she is given an easier set of questions under Activity 3. These are called “Standard.” Math: If a student scores greater than 85% in Activity 1 and 2, the student is put on an “Advanced” track for Word Problems under Activity 3. Otherwise, the student remains on the “Intermediate” track.
English: If a student scores greater than 85% in Activity 1 and 2 of Comprehension, the student is put on the “Advanced” track under Activity 3. Otherwise, the student remains on the “Intermediate” track.
